Transaction 143b9183bc19fe246e4d7d5dc73a7fdeeeabb0f955494a012b35775d9b7d81e4

1 Input
2 Outputs
  • 143b9183bc19fe246e4d7d5dc73a7fdeeeabb0f955494a012b35775d9b7d81e4:0
  • value  3675
    address  16hbsunCyNz3TPwb7G83z9MWRBcUbs6Ats
  • 143b9183bc19fe246e4d7d5dc73a7fdeeeabb0f955494a012b35775d9b7d81e4:1
  • value  500000
    address  1MLwkdt523uRmBocviWSFtZJYjjQrEVKZK